Совет по установке генты - GRUB

Ставлю под хедбуку, но из убунты. Пока сделано это

Планируется так: Винт разбит на 4 части.
SWAP - 0275f8fd-e839-4ee0-bc4d-ba56bbb0f211 -> ../../sda1
Gentoo / (ext4) 7e6e5281-c131-49f5-9044-9038d206527a -> ../../sda7
Ubuntu / (etx4) 98617b14-0053-40f7-be91-5c20ee548579 -> ../../sda5
/boot (ext2) для Ubuntu и Gentoo c9a56323-f109-4951-927b-fb775a82d14b -> ../../sda6

В /boot скорпирован образ ядра linux-2.6.35-gentoo-r4. Пологаю, остается только прописать в уже имеющийся /boot/grub/grub.cfg загрузку самой генты. Но тут возникают вопросы.

Вот так выглядит полный grub.cfg

Казалось достаточно добавить пару строк по примеру убунты - прим.

menuentry 'Gentoo, with linux-2.6.35-gentoo-r4' --class gentoo --class gnu-linux --class gnu --class os {
	recordfail
	insmod ext2
	set root='(hd0,6)'
	search --no-floppy --fs-uuid --set c9a56323-f109-4951-927b-fb775a82d14b
	linux	/linux-2.6.35-gentoo-r4 root=UUID=7e6e5281-c131-49f5-9044-9038d206527a ro   quiet #splash нужно-ли?
	initrd	/? #что сюда прописать? Где взять initramfsчто-то там..?
}

Что косается initrd, в /media/%uuid%/usr/src/linux-2.6.35-gentoo-r4/usr нашел initramfs_data.cpio, может оно? Но оно содержимым отличается от initrd.img-2.6.32-24-generic-pae.

Да и после update-grub, разумеется строки пропадают. Как-то я все не так делаю.

Надеюсь понятно изъяснил проблему. Пожалуйста, поправте меня.

как бэ initrd не обязателен,

как бэ initrd не обязателен, система может с без него грузиться, так что параметр можно просто опустить, но если все же не ймется,то...

genkernel ramdisk

или

emerge -av dracut
dracut -v -H -f /boot/initrd

Пропадают...это кривости второго граба, нужно полностью прописать только gentoo в /etc/grub.d/40_custom (В ubuntu) Тогда пропадать не будут.

Все мы, рано или поздно, будем там...

Ну не кривости, это фича.

Ну не кривости, это фича. Просто изменился подход к формированию конфига

В хендбуке описаны два метода

В хендбуке описаны два метода установки ядра. Один подразумевает установку только ядра, другой (genkernel) - initramfs. Определись, какой твой выбор.

Не грусти, товарищ! Всё хорошо, beautiful good!

Настройки просмотра комментариев

Выберите нужный метод показа комментариев и нажмите "Сохранить установки".